John C. is the sixth episode of the fifth season of the acclaimed Emmy-winning series, Intervention. The show follows the lives of individuals suffering from addiction and how their families seek out professional help to intervene and help them turn their lives around.

In this episode, we meet John, a 34-year-old man from St. Paul, Minnesota. John was raised in a strict and religious family but found himself struggling with addiction at an early age. He started with alcohol at the age of 15, and soon after tried methamphetamine, cocaine, and other hard drugs. His mother, who is also a recovering addict, tried her best to help him, but John's addiction continued to spiral out of control.

John has been in and out of rehab over the years, but his addiction has always managed to catch up with him. He lost a job he had for 10 years because of his addiction and eventually started selling drugs to keep up with his habit. His family is aware of his addiction, and his sister and other family members have tried to help him, but it hasn't been successful.

The episode follows John and his family as they plan an intervention to help him get the help he needs. The interventionist, Jeff VanVonderen, meets with the family to prepare for the intervention. He learns about John's history and addiction, which includes overdoses and near-death experiences.

At the intervention, John is surprised and overwhelmed to see his family gathered in one place. However, it's not easy convincing him to seek help, and he initially resists the idea of going to rehab. It's clear that John is still struggling with accepting his addiction and seeing a way out of it.

Throughout the episode, we see John's family share their experiences and the toll it has taken on them. They describe how they have had to put their lives on hold to help John, and the fear that they have every time he relapses. Seeing the impact that his addiction has had on his loved ones, as well as the consequences he has faced, finally convinces John to go to rehab.

We follow John's journey as he goes through detox and starts to work on his addiction at a residential treatment center. His journey is filled with ups and downs, and there are moments where he feels like giving up. However, with the support of his family and the interventionist, he is able to persevere and make progress.

There are moments during John's journey where we see him start to recognize the ways in which his addiction has affected his life. He starts to take responsibility for his actions and begins to work on rebuilding relationships with his family.

Overall, John C. is a poignant episode that shows the impact of addiction not only on the individual but also on their loved ones. It's a reminder of the importance of seeking help, and the power of family and support when working towards recovery.
